Nigerian singer Nonso Amadi has seemingly waded into the
recent sad developments across the country. In a Facebook post he shared, he stated that "Nigerians are loud in their laughter and silent in their suffering. Nonso wrote; We Nigerians are loud in our laughter, silent in our suffering.https://www.facebook.com/100044386660972/posts/547877653368452/?app=fbl 1 Like
